Webbhydrostatics, Branch of physics that deals with the characteristics of fluids at rest, particularly with the pressure in a fluid or exerted by a fluid (gas or liquid) on an immersed body. Webb8 dec. 2024 · This calculator determines the water depth to reach a given pressure or the pressure at a given depth. You can enter the depth or pressure input with most common units and it will be converted automatically. This calculator does not add air pressure at the surface – the results are relative to the surface pressure. Link to these results. WebbDensity is defined as the ratio of mass per unit volume.
